Dr. Khanday has done Post-Doctoral Research from Universiti Sains Malyasia (USM) with Bassim H. Hameed. Presently he's working as Assistant Professor, Chemistry at Sri Pratap College Srinagar. Dr. Khanday's research interest is waste processing into activated carbon and other composites to be utilized as noval adsorbents for waste water treatment. He has significantly contributed in the field of waste water treatment by publishing highly citable articles in Q1 Journals with more than 10 articles having 100 Plus citations. He has published more than 50 high Impact research articles in SCI journals with overall citations near to 4000 and has h-index & i10-index of 27 & 35 respectively. Besides He's reviewer for many SCI journals. He has has been listed among world's top 2% scientists by Stanford University, USA/Elsevier for the year 2025.
